Arkansas Methodist Medical Center and Baptist Memorial Health Care to Merge

They have signed a non-binding letter of intent to complete a shared mission agreement to merge the two organizations.

By HFT Staff


Arkansas Methodist Medical Center in Paragould, Arkansas, and Baptist Memorial Health Care in Memphis have signed a non-binding letter of intent to complete a shared mission agreement to merge the two organizations. 

Baptist Memorial Health Care has 24 hospitals in West Tennessee, Mississippi and Northeast Arkansas, with two of those hospitals in Crittenden and Craighead counties in Arkansas. Baptist, which had a net operating revenue of $4.4 billion in fiscal year 2024, most recently completed successful mergers with Anderson Regional Health System in Meridian, Mississippi, in 2024 and Mississippi Baptist Health System based in Jackson, Mississippi, in 2017. 

Baptist Memorial and AMMC are in the early phases of discussions but expect to finalize an agreement by early 2026.
